Chargers edge Reavis 3-2

Palos Hills, IL (March 20, 2012) - The Rams&; offense was stifled Tuesday in their 3-2 loss to Stagg High School.  Reavis hitters could muster just four hits on the day and struck out seven times.  "Stagg&;s pitcher changed speeds well all game," said Coach Erickson, "and he really kept our hitters off-balance."

Senior pitcher Anthony Doory, who didn&;t have his best stuff on the mound, was still able to keep the Rams in the game.  He went 5.1 innings, allowing three runs on six hits, while striking out five Chargers.

Despite a dearth of hitting, Reavis tied the game 1-1 in the fourth inning when Jake Stano doubled and eventually scored on Doory&;s fielder&;s choice, and they took a 2-1 lead in the top of the sixth when David Beltran scored on a passed ball.

However, Stagg scored twice in the bottom of the frame and shut down the Ram offense in the seventh inning to preserve the 3-2 victory.
